From: FUJITA Tomonori This sets the segment size limit properly via pci_set_dma_max_seg_size and remove blk_queue_max_segment_size because scsi-ml calls it. Signed-off-by: FUJITA Tomonori Cc: Jeff Garzik Cc: James Bottomley Cc: Jens Axboe Signed-off-by: Andrew Morton --- drivers/ata/sata_inic162x.c | 25 +++++++++++++------------ 1 file changed, 13 insertions(+), 12 deletions(-) diff -puN drivers/ata/sata_inic162x.c~iommu-sg-merging-sata_inic162x-use-pci_set_dma_max_seg_size drivers/ata/sata_inic162x.c --- a/drivers/ata/sata_inic162x.c~iommu-sg-merging-sata_inic162x-use-pci_set_dma_max_seg_size +++ a/drivers/ata/sata_inic162x.c @@ -108,17 +108,6 @@ struct inic_port_priv { u8 cached_pirq_mask; }; -static int inic_slave_config(struct scsi_device *sdev) -{ - /* This controller is braindamaged. dma_boundary is 0xffff - * like others but it will lock up the whole machine HARD if - * 65536 byte PRD entry is fed. Reduce maximum segment size. - */ - blk_queue_max_segment_size(sdev->request_queue, 65536 - 512); - - return ata_scsi_slave_config(sdev); -} - static struct scsi_host_template inic_sht = { .module = THIS_MODULE, .name = DRV_NAME, @@ -132,7 +121,7 @@ static struct scsi_host_template inic_sh .use_clustering = ATA_SHT_USE_CLUSTERING, .proc_name = DRV_NAME, .dma_boundary = ATA_DMA_BOUNDARY, - .slave_configure = inic_slave_config, + .slave_configure = ata_scsi_slave_config, .slave_destroy = ata_scsi_slave_destroy, .bios_param = ata_std_bios_param, }; @@ -730,6 +719,18 @@ static int inic_init_one(struct pci_dev return rc; } + /* + * This controller is braindamaged. dma_boundary is 0xffff + * like others but it will lock up the whole machine HARD if + * 65536 byte PRD entry is fed. Reduce maximum segment size. + */ + rc = pci_set_dma_max_seg_size(pdev, 65536 - 512); + if (rc) { + dev_printk(KERN_ERR, &pdev->dev, + "failed to set the maximum segment size.\n"); + return rc; + } + rc = init_controller(iomap[MMIO_BAR], hpriv->cached_hctl); if (rc) { dev_printk(KERN_ERR, &pdev->dev, _
